SoloCodigo
Programación General => C/C++ => Mensaje iniciado por: jodijo5 en Sábado 27 de Agosto de 2005, 04:59
-
tengo un reto para que se auemen las pestañas ya lo hice estaba bien dificil pero no imposible.
tengo un rectangulo de 40 por 20 unidades
y voy ingresando un rectangulo de x por y unidades y lo que debe hacer el programa es ubicar el cuadrado en un lugar dentro de este rectangulo de 40 por 20 con la finalidad de que se desperdicie el minimo de espacio
una ayudita: repasen ecuaciones diferenciales y borland c++
-
es como duro pero no he visto ese tema pero me gustaria aprenderlo si ahy guias por ahy avisemen por favor B)
-
aqui te dejo algunas direcciones:
si quieres aprender sobre c++, un buen tutorial que mas parece libro es cplusplus (http://www.cplusplus.com)
para ecuaciones diferenciales, consulta con tus profes, jeje, una broma sin sabor, matematicas (http://www.matematicas.net)
-
gracias pero primero mandeme un link para aprender ingles :P :D pero lo voy a revisar
-
Hola... no se si todabia estas interesado pero ese mismo programa lo tengo hecho porque lo tuve que presentar en un practica de una asignatura. Si aun te interesa dimelo y te digo como es, lo tengo implementando mediante un algoritmo devorador.
Salu2
-
tengo un reto para que se auemen las pestañas ya lo hice estaba bien dificil pero no imposible.
tengo un rectangulo de 40 por 20 unidades
y voy ingresando un rectangulo de x por y unidades y lo que debe hacer el programa es ubicar el cuadrado en un lugar dentro de este rectangulo de 40 por 20 con la finalidad de que se desperdicie el minimo de espacio
una ayudita: repasen ecuaciones diferenciales y borland c++
Ehh.. a qué te refieres con que ocupe el menos espacio posible?
Es decir, si el rectángulo interior es de un determinado X por un determinado Y, entonces el espacio de diferencia será siempre igual, es decir, no importa donde esté ubicado el interior.
Como ven, estoy algo atontado con estas cosas.
-
imaginate que tienes un rectangulo de tela, dentro de este rectangulo cortas un pedazo(un rectangulo claro esta), cortas otro y otro y otro, pero tienes que ubicar cada corte de tal manera que aproveches la mayor cantidad de tela posible.
es un ejemplo practico con el que muchos programadores se topan.y casi por ahi va el reto este
-
Es decir jodijo5, buenas tardes, que arranca el programa y hay un rectangulo pintado en la pantalla, de 40 por 20 unidades (estas unidades son en modo texto verdad?) y me deja meter el tamaño x y de un rectangulo, que tiene que ser mas pequeño que el primero que lo pinta sobre este, cierto?
Se me pide otro rectangulo, y lo pinta encima del primero o al lado y asì hasta que no quepan mas rectangulos???????????
suena bacano ese programa, saludos
ciao
-
Te doy una idea de como es, la figura que te paso es mi rectangulo, de 20 por 40, en el voy agregando cuadrado por cuadrado, y a medida que voy agregando cada uno, se ubica en una posicion determinada por el programa, con el fin de que quede el menor espacio en blanco posible.
-
ups, se me olvidó la figura
-
ups, se me olvido de nuevo
-
A ver.. es decir que obtener "mayor espacio" significaría el dejar libre un rectángulo lo más grande posible? Puesto que el espacio libre es siempre el mismo...
(Creo que ahí resolví mi duda)
-
sip